MLF to Launch "Ukay - Ukay" Fundraiser Benefiting War-Affected Children
The Mindanao Land Foundation Inc. (MLF/MinLand), a Non Government Organization based in Davao City and Kidapawan City in partnership with Move On Philippines International (MOP), an organization of Filipino migrants in Jacksonville, Florida, USA will launch an Ukay - Ukay Fund Raising Activity on June 20 - 21, 2008 at Matina Town Square, Matina, Davao City to benefit the disadvantaged students in conflict affected areas in North Cotabato.
Proceeds from the two-day fund raising activity will support a "School Breakfast Program" for the students of Datu Ambel Memorial High School in Barangay Kilada, Matalam, Cotabato.
School Breakfast Program is a pilot project of MinLand for School Year 2008 - 2009 which aims to help increase motivation of students in conflict affected areas to finish high school as well as to provide nourishment and energy to respond to the everyday physical and mental challenges in school.
Datu Ambel Memorial High School primarily caters students coming from poor families in conflict affected barangays in the municipality of Matalam, North Cotabato. Many of its students have experienced the hardship associated with conflict: tension, hunger, harassment, illnesses, evacuation, homelessness, disruption of schooling, separation and/or death of family member/s and friends.
Matina Town Square is supporting the activity by providing a space in its flea market (tiangge) area, free of charge, where pre-owned clothing and other items gathered by MOP volunteers in the United States and MinLand in the Philippines will be displayed for sale.

BACK TO SCHOOL. Aside from going to school hungry most of the time, students of Datu Ambel Memorial High School also endure the long walk to and from school where some even cross a river on foot. To support these children's aspirations, the school's PTCA, MinLand Foundation, Move on Philippines International, Matina Town Square and private donors are embarking on a school breakfast program.
